Transaction 510637c76eefcaf3bff659a5d2d1ef7ea964e5aafd0a05530652bb5c205a020f

1 Input
2 Outputs
  • 510637c76eefcaf3bff659a5d2d1ef7ea964e5aafd0a05530652bb5c205a020f:0
  • value  9201604
    address  3MpZyDJvCvVczQxpfEaZskJ3qtaxFdVSMW
  • 510637c76eefcaf3bff659a5d2d1ef7ea964e5aafd0a05530652bb5c205a020f:1
  • value  1918046
    address  1J7VdEFGNYNA1BJxLhGWpvc8ApuJGegX9o